Style Me Africa, new fashion website inspired by all things Africa, has released a debut campaign editorial, inspired by their love for Nigerian fashion.
According to Style Me Africa, “Our culture is full of life and colour. Nigerian and African designers alike are known for the use of colourful and bold prints, rich ankara and lace fabrics (amongst others) and we decided to celebrate them with this campaign. Nigerian Fashion has grown immensely over the years. Thousands of new designers join the industry every year and the design process has completely evolved from just basic Ankara styles to include very chic and wearable fashion that caters to every woman! Our website was created to celebrate Fashion and design inspired by Africa and we hope to educate the world on just how talented our continent really is. We hope you love our debut campaign photos as much as we do.
In the editorial the models wear Nigerian brands such as Lanre Da Silva, Grey, Alter Ego, Virgos Lounge, Adey Soile and more.
